Installing

The extension is distributed directly rather than through the Chrome Web Store, so installation is one extra step. It takes about a minute and you only do it once.

  1. Download the zip and unzip it somewhere you will keep it. Chrome loads the extension from this folder every time it starts — if you delete the folder, the extension disappears.
  2. Open chrome://extensions.
  3. Turn on Developer mode using the toggle at the top right.
  4. Click Load unpacked and select the unzipped folder — the one containing manifest.json.
  5. Click the puzzle-piece icon in your toolbar and pin the extension.
  6. Click the extension icon and paste your activation key.

Chrome may show a "Disable developer mode extensions" prompt on startup. Dismissing it is safe — the extension keeps working.

Running an extraction

  1. Search Google Maps as you normally would, so businesses appear in the left-hand list.
  2. Set your filters in the panel at the top right.
  3. Pick an extraction depth (see below).
  4. Click Start, then Export CSV when it finishes.

Results save continuously, so a refresh or a crash mid-run loses nothing. Stop halts the run and keeps what it has. Clear wipes the stored set — do that between unrelated searches, or the results merge.

Extraction depth

Smart hybrid

Reads the list, then opens only the listings missing a phone or website. The default, and the right choice most of the time.

Deep

Opens every listing. Slower — about three seconds each — but the only mode that gets full addresses, postcodes and seven-day opening hours, because list cards never contain them.

List only

No listing visits at all. Fastest, but addresses are partial and the unclaimed filter cannot work.

Filter reference

Filters are applied while results are collected, not afterwards. That matters: a rejected business is never opened, so it costs no time and none of your daily allowance.

Two filters need a listing visit and therefore do not work in List-only mode: Unclaimed listings and Has an email. A location filter is also more accurate with visits, because a results card usually shows only a street, not the town.

Likely new is an estimate. Google Maps publishes no opening date anywhere, so this filter uses a low review count or Google's own New badge. Treat it as a strong hint, not a fact.

Exclude chains drops any business sharing a website domain or an exact name with more than N others in your results. Set N to 1 to keep only genuinely independent businesses.

Stop after N caps a run at N businesses that passed your filters. Scrolling and listing visits both stop early, so a small cap really is fast.

Email lookup

Google Maps never exposes email addresses. If you want them, enable email lookup from the extension popup and grant website access. The extension then visits each business's own site — the homepage, /contact, /contact-us and /about — and pulls contact addresses.

Requests are sent without cookies, so a site you are signed in to cannot return your own account details instead of the business's. You can also add your own addresses to a blocklist in the popup, which strips them from every export.

Troubleshooting

The panel does not appear
It only mounts on a Google Maps search page with a results list. Search for something first. If it still does not appear, reload the tab.
Far fewer results than expected
Google caps a single search at roughly 120 results and throttles when you have been busy. The same search can return 76 one minute and 14 the next. Wait a few minutes, or split the area into narrower searches and let the extension merge them.
"Google is showing a verification challenge"
You have been extracting hard enough that Google wants a CAPTCHA. The extension stops rather than pushing through. Wait several minutes before resuming, and consider Smart hybrid instead of Deep.
"Enter your activation key to start"
Click the extension icon in the toolbar and paste the key from your email.
"This key is already active on N devices"
Open the popup on the machine you no longer use and click Deactivate this device, or manage devices from your account page.
Addresses are blank or partial
Only Deep mode gets full addresses. Results-list cards genuinely do not contain them.
